Universidade Zambeze / University Zambeze - Unizambeze

Universidade Zambeze / University Zambeze - Unizambeze

General
Jobs 0
Shortlists/Awards 1
Pricing strategy 0
Partners/Competitors 10
Last update: Apr 8, 2025
General
Jobs
Shortlists/Awards
Pricing strategy
Partners/Competitors
No results